The UUA is sponsoring a way for UUs who identify as People of Color all across the country to meet. In May 2013, UUs of Color began gathering online and by phone for conversation, support, and community. This meeting space is to support communities of color within the Unitarian Universalist faith. Participation is limited to people of color (including the diversities listed above). Adults, young adults, elders, and youth are all welcome. Please spread this good news.
